MILLBURY - Two police officers under investigation had entered the Police Department's locked armory without permission after the "Goods for Guns" gun buyback day Dec. 12 and had taken a small-caliber semi-automatic pistol to try out, according to the "Millbury Firearm Investigation" report completed by the state police detective unit assigned to the Worcester district attorney's office.

The Telegram & Gazette obtained the report, dated Feb. 15, through a public records request.

Officers Anthony J. Belliveau and Robert J. Guyan Jr. have been on paid administrative leave since late December while the state police detective's investigation and an internal investigation were going on.
